What is Ankylosing Spondylitis?

Ankylosing Spondylitis is a form of arthritis that causes inflammation in the spine, hips, and sometimes shoulders. Over time, this inflammation can lead to stiffness, reduced mobility, and in severe cases, fusion of the spine.

Unlike temporary backaches, AS is a progressive condition that requires active management to preserve flexibility and independence.

Common Symptoms

Persistent back pain and stiffness, often worse in the morning or after rest.
Pain in the lower back, buttocks, hips, or shoulders.
Reduced spinal flexibility, leading to a stooped posture.
Fatigue due to chronic inflammation.
In some cases, chest pain from reduced rib mobility or eye inflammation (uveitis).

Symptoms often begin gradually and worsen over time, making early detection and intervention critical.

Causes and Risk Factors

The exact cause of AS remains unclear, but factors include:

Genetics: Most people with AS carry the HLA-B27 gene.
Immune response: The immune system mistakenly targets spinal joints.
Age & gender: It often begins in the late teens or early adulthood and is more common in men.
Family history: A close relative with AS increases your risk.

Why Early Physiotherapy Matters

Ankylosing Spondylitis cannot be cured, but with early and consistent physiotherapy, symptoms can be controlled, flare-ups reduced, and long-term complications prevented. Without treatment, the condition may lead to significant spinal rigidity, making even simple activities difficult.

1. Detailed Assessment

Evaluating spinal mobility, posture, and flexibility.
Identifying areas of inflammation and stiffness.
Understanding lifestyle, daily challenges, and personal goals.

2. Pain & Inflammation Control

Heat therapy to relax stiff muscles.
Cold therapy during flare-ups.
Electrotherapy to reduce pain and improve circulation.

3. Manual Therapy

Gentle joint mobilizations to maintain spinal movement.
Soft tissue massage to ease muscle tightness.
Hands-on stretching for targeted flexibility.

4. Tailored Exercise Programs

Exercise is at the heart of physiotherapy for ankylosing spondylitis in Krishna Nagar, Delhi. Our plans include:

Postural correction drills to prevent slouching.
Flexibility stretches for the spine, hips, and shoulders.
Core strengthening to stabilize the spine.
Breathing exercises to maintain rib mobility and lung capacity.

5. Education & Lifestyle Modifications

Ergonomic guidance for desk jobs.
Sleep advice for neck and back support.
Daily movement strategies to reduce stiffness.

6. Long-Term Monitoring

We adjust your plan as your condition changes, ensuring continuous improvement and prevention of complications.

1. Can physiotherapy cure Ankylosing Spondylitis?

No, physiotherapy cannot cure AS, but it can greatly reduce symptoms, maintain spinal flexibility, and prevent long-term complications. Many patients lead active lives with regular physiotherapy support.

2. How long will I need physiotherapy for AS?

AS is a chronic condition, so physiotherapy is often a long-term part of management. While flare-ups may need more frequent sessions, maintenance exercises at home can keep symptoms under control.

3. Are there specific exercises I should avoid with AS?

Yes. High-impact activities that strain the spine should be avoided during flare-ups. Instead, focus on guided exercises that improve posture, flexibility, and core strength under a physiotherapist's supervision.

4. Will Ankylosing Spondylitis get worse over time?

If untreated, AS may lead to spinal stiffness and fusion. However, early intervention with physiotherapy, lifestyle changes, and medical management can significantly slow progression and preserve mobility.

5. Is physiotherapy safe during flare-ups?

Yes, but exercises may need to be modified. Gentle stretching, posture training, and breathing exercises are safe, while high-intensity activities should be paused until the flare subsides.
